Additional capabilities to consider in a lead management comparison

Beyond core differences, several technical and operational features can affect implementation and daily use for sales and operations teams.

Integration

signNow offers native connectors and API endpoints to push signed documents or pull signer status into CRM systems, enabling synchronized contract records.

API and Webhooks

Both platforms support APIs; signNow focuses on eSignature transaction events and document retrieval, while Insightly exposes CRM object operations and webhooks for pipeline automation.

Mobile Access

Mobile apps allow signing and basic record updates; signNow emphasizes on-device signing and form completion for field-based sales teams.

Bulk Send

signNow supports sending identical documents to many recipients efficiently, useful for mass enrollment or renewal campaigns tied to lead lists.

Templates

Reusable document templates reduce preparation time and ensure consistent contract language across sales opportunities.

Compliance Controls

Role-based access, retention settings, and verifiable audit trails help meet ESIGN, UETA, and sector-specific compliance needs.

Core feature differences affecting lead management

Four areas commonly influence which platform better supports sales processes: how leads are captured and enriched, how documents are generated and signed, what automation is available, and how reporting ties to closed deals.

Lead Capture

Insightly focuses on CRM-native lead capture, activity history, and relationship linking to opportunities, while signNow integrates captured lead data into signature templates to expedite contract generation and signing.

Document Generation

signNow provides template-based document assembly with mapped fields and reusable templates, reducing manual edits when creating sales contracts from CRM lead data.

Automation

Insightly offers sales automation for pipelines and tasks, while signNow provides automation primarily around document routing, reminders, and bulk send to multiple signers for recurring programs.

Reporting

Insightly's CRM reporting focuses on pipeline and opportunity metrics; signNow supplements with signature completion analytics and document-level audit data that can be fed back into sales reports.

Best practices for secure and accurate lead-to-sign processes

Guidelines to reduce errors, maintain compliance, and speed up lead conversion when integrating signing into sales workflows.

Standardize templates and clauses
Maintain a small set of approved templates and standardized clause libraries to ensure legal consistency and reduce the chance of manual errors when generating documents from lead data.
Map CRM fields consistently
Define and document field mappings between lead records and contract templates so data populates correctly and reduces mismatches in customer names, pricing, and effective dates.
Use role-based access control
Restrict who can send, modify, and access signed documents. Implement least-privilege permissions and audit access to sensitive agreement information.
Log and monitor signature events
Enable comprehensive audit logging and periodically review signature activity, failed attempts, and exceptions to detect anomalies and improve operational SLAs.
